Strategic Tensions

Validation vs. commoditization

First-party mobile/persistence releases validate the job, but they commoditize visible phone control. The durable claim moves down-stack to neutral infrastructure, approval policy, session lifecycle, and BYO-client control.

Neutrality vs. convenience

The ICP says vendor lock-in is a deal-breaker, but first-party tools win by being bundled, default, and already authenticated. gblock-party must prove neutrality is worth another account and workflow.

Predictable pricing vs. expensive agent workloads

Pricing backlash creates an opening, but flat pricing can only cover orchestration/infrastructure unless usage is capped or BYOK.

Enterprise governance vs. solo operations

The safer wedge is not to out-enterprise OpenAI-Ona, Cursor, or GitHub; it is to provide solo/small-team operational control without procurement, enterprise setup, or vendor lock-in.
